Known for its excellent food and impressive service, Warong Shanghai Blue 1920 was established in memory of Siti Djaenab who, in 1920, opened a simple food stall with the help of her husband, Chan Mo Sang, in Sunda Kelapa. What started as a humble hawker business grew into a famous jazz and tea house that developed into one of the hippest venues in Batavia and became a home away from home for sailors. Dining in this restaurant is nostalgic. The décor, furnishings, sights and sounds, the smell of the food and, of course, the wonderful live jazz will whisk you back to days when life appeared simpler and everyone seemed younger. The food is like the environment, a fusion of Chinese, Betawi and international influences, where dishes like Shanghai Blue Red Chicken, a recipe from Chang Mo Sang’s very own mother, is popular, as is its famous dim sum.
